[24] In 2014, the traditional agricultural practice of cultivating the vite ad alberello (head-trained bush vines) of the community of Pantelleria was inscribed on the Representative List of the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ity of UNESCO.[25]. 1 Full-day Tours from 5,504.39 per adult Lunch or dinner and cooking demo at a local's home in Pantelleria from 7,797.89 per adult The area Via Montagna Grande SNC Pantelleria, 91017, Sicily Italy Full view Best nearby Restaurants It's wild and beautiful. A dammuso is a dry stone building with thick walls that usually appear black due to the extensive use of volcanic rock. As a fellow passenger explained it, landing on Pantelleria requires near perfect conditions because the airport sits at the edge of a mountain, which can prevent navigational instruments from being much use. [13] The eruption that formed the Cinque Denti caldera produced the distinctive green tuff deposit that covers much of the island, and is found across the Mediterranean, as far away as the island of Lesbos in the Aegean. The BEST Pantelleria Culinary & nightlife 2022 - GetYourGuide They are similar in character to the nuraghe of Sardinia, though of smaller size, and consist of round or elliptical towers with sepulchral chambers in them, built of rough blocks of lava. Throughout the island you'll find Pantelleria's unique dammusi lava rock houses with thick, whitewashed walls, shallow cupolas, and cisterns for collecting rainwater. The island of Pantelleria is located above a drowned continental rift in the Strait of Sicily and has been the focus of intensive volcano-tectonic activity. Best seller!! The Favare are steam emissions, reaching up to 100C which come out of cracks in the rock. During the Napoleonic Wars, the British considered the possibility of taking over Pantelleria (together with Lampedusa and Linosa) so as to be able to supply Malta, but a Royal Commission stated in an 1812 report that there would be considerable difficulties in this venture.[11]. The original Arab name for the island was Bint al-Riyh (Arabic: and Maltese: Bint l-Irjie), meaning "Daughter of the Winds" after the strong gales that can arise off the north coast of Africa. Pantelleria (Italian pronunciation: [pantelleria]; Sicilian: Pantiddira), the ancient Cossyra or Cossura, is an Italian island and comune in the Strait of Sicily in the Mediterranean Sea, 100 kilometres (55 nautical miles) southwest of Sicily and 60 km (30 nmi) east of the Tunisian coast. The two most dramatic views are at Elefante, an enormous outcropping of rock that resembles an elephant's trunk making an arch from land to sea, and Salta-la-Vecchia, a soaring and especially dramatic series of cliffs.
